    Chicken Coops Insulation Strategies

    Effective chicken hen house insulation strategies are crucial for guaranteeing the well-being and output of poultry during cold months. Insulating hen houses reduces climatic fluctuations, avoiding strain and illness in poultry, which can lead to lowered laying rates. Current trends indicate that knowledgeable poultry keepers are opting for materials that maximize thermal efficiency while reducing expenses.

Research shows that chickens require between 20% to 30% more calories in winter due to lower temperatures and reduced forage availability. To satisfy these needs, many keepers are adding energy-rich grains and protein sources, such as soya and mealworms, into their feed blends. Additionally, the supplementation of vitamins and minerals can boost immune responses, helping to combat cold-related stress. Trends reveal a shift towards personalized feeding schedules, allowing for better adjustment to specific flock situations. By optimizing winter nutrition, poultry keepers can improve egg production and overall flock durability throughout the challenging winter months.
